Comparing Nutrients in 100 calories Boiled PurslaneVS Canned Red Kidney Beans with Liquids
Weight per 100 calories
Boiled Purslane
556g
Canned Red Kidney Beans with Liquids
124g
Canned Red Kidney Beans Solids and Liquids have 4.5 times more energy per unit of mass than Boiled and Drained Purslane, which is average in comparison to other foods. Boiled Purslane having very low energy density.

Lets compare vitamin content per 100 calories of Boiled Purslane vs Canned Red Kidney Beans with Liquids:
100 calories of Boiled Purslane have more Vitamin A, 1.3 times more Vitamin B1, 6 times more Vitamin B2, 4.2 times more Vitamin B3, 1.2 times more Vitamin B5, 3.9 times more Vitamin B6, 1.8 times more Vitamin B9 and 59.1 times more Vitamin C than Canned Red Kidney Beans with Liquids.
100 calories of Canned Red Kidney Beans with Liquids have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A and Vitamin C
Both Boiled and Drained Purslane as well as Canned Red Kidney Beans Solids and Liquids have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 100 calories.
Comparing minerals per 100 calories for Boiled Purslane vs Canned Red Kidney Beans with Liquids:
100 calories of Boiled Purslane have 12.1 times more Calcium, 3.5 times more Copper, 2.8 times more Iron, 10.1 times more Magnesium, 4.7 times more Manganese, 1.6 times more Phosphorus, 8.4 times more Potassium, 3.7 times more Selenium, 1.2 times more Zinc and 5.4 times more Water than Canned Red Kidney Beans with Liquids.
While 100 kcal of Canned Red Kidney Beans Solids and Liquids contain 1.3 times more Sodium than Boiled and Drained Purslane.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 100 calories:
100 calories of Boiled Purslane have 1.3 times more Protein than Canned Red Kidney Beans with Liquids.
Both Boiled Purslane and Canned Red Kidney Beans with Liquids offer comparable quantities of Energy and Carbohydrate per 100 calories.
